Water Quality Snapshot: Midway Mobile Homes LLC

Midway Mobile Homes LLC is a private-owned community water system that delivers drinking water to 213 residents in La Jolla, Ohio (Trumbull County) through 62 service connections. Its water is drawn from groundwater sources. EPA's Safe Drinking Water Information System records 147 total violations for this system , of which 0 (0%) are health-based, meaning a contaminant exceeded an EPA Maximum Contaminant Level or a required treatment technique failed. A further 122 monitoring and reporting violations are on file. The most recent violation on record dates to 2024.

The most frequently cited contaminant at this system is Coliform (TCR), recorded in 24 violations (MR). This system has not yet been sampled under EPA's UCMR5 PFAS monitoring program, so no PFAS detection data is available here.

Across Ohio, EPA tracks 4,181 public water systems serving 11,085,226 people, with 288,388 cumulative violations and 52,412 health-based violations on record. About 90% of systems in the state carry at least one violation, and state-wide the average per system is 69 violations. Statewide, 204 of 346 UCMR5-tested systems have reported PFAS detections (59%).

Midway Mobile Homes LLC's 147 violations sit above the Ohio average.

Federal MCL reference, Safe Drinking Water Act thresholds
Contaminant Federal MCL / Action Level Note
Lead 0 mg/L (Action Level: 0.015 mg/L) Lead and Copper Rule treatment technique
Arsenic 0.010 mg/L (10 ppb) Health-based MCL since 2006
Total Coliform Treatment technique (RTCR) Indicator organism, monitoring trigger
PFOA / PFOS (PFAS) 4.0 ppt each (final 2024 rule) Compliance deadline 2029 (EPA proposed extending to 2031, not yet final as of May 2026)
Nitrate (as N) 10 mg/L Acute health risk for infants
